Enterprises Fuel Growth in Project Portfolio Management Market with Agile Strategies

As the business landscape continues to evolve, enterprises are increasingly turning to Project Portfolio Management (PPM) solutions to enhance strategic alignment and bolster their competitive edge. According to openPR.com, the global PPM market is on a meteoric rise, expected to swell from USD 5.8 billion in 2024 to an impressive USD 18.9 billion by 2034. This surge is propelled by the widespread adoption of cloud-native platforms and artificial intelligence-driven analytics.

Key Players and Innovations

Leading PPM vendors like Microsoft, SAP, Oracle, and Broadcom (Clarity PPM) are at the forefront of this technological shift. These companies are not only enhancing their platforms with predictive analytics and workflow automation features but also integrating them with CRM, ERP, HRM, and collaboration suites to offer a seamless project management experience.

Market Segmentation and Growth Insights

The PPM market is broadly segmented by component, deployment mode, enterprise size, application, and industry vertical. Solutions such as portfolio management and resource management lead the pack, with services showing remarkable growth due to the complexity of implementations. Notably, sectors such as IT, BFSI, and construction continue to dominate, though healthcare and manufacturing are catching up swiftly.

Regional Dynamics

Regional dynamics paint an equally exciting picture. North America holds the largest market share due to robust enterprise investments and cloud adoption. Europe follows closely, driven by stringent compliance requirements. Notably, Asia-Pacific is the fastest-growing region, attributed to swift digital transformation across nations like India, China, and Japan.
